点file点new创建 android application project
application name 应用名字
project name 工程名
Package name 包名 一般是公司名
Minimum Required SDK 最低的SDK版本
Trget SDK 目标版本
Creagte sustom launcher创建一个桌面图标,就是点下就开始运行程序的那个图标
Create activity
部署程序,点击工程右键 run as android project或者点击三角符号。或者快捷键ctrl+f1.
src目录存放源码的。
gen目录 R.java很重要的自动生成的文件不要修改它。
Android 开发环境需要的jar包
Android Denpendcies 依赖的包
assets 放音频视频等的目录
bin 存放dex文件。最后打包生成的apk。
libs 引用的第三方jar包就存放在这里
res 所有的资源文件,包括图片资源,布局资源。一般放hdpi,里面的资源会在R.java里面记录。
通过R.java可以找到res下面的资源。
layout 布局文件也放在res下面。
menu
values Strings 定义了藏用的字符串。
屏幕适配
manifest.xml清单文件,类似servlet的配置文件。里面的versionName还可以随意修改。
auto monitor logcat 日志猫
点击window-showview-logcat可以打开日志猫
minSDKVwesion=“”最低Sdk版本一般用8就可以了
application 当前的应用
allowBackup是否备份
@可以就理解成R文件,在里面找到需要的资源
@理解成R文件,很重要。
<activity>
<intent-filter>
LAUNCHER启动
MainActivity第一次启动的activity
onCreate方法called when activity is starting当activity启动时运行
set the activity content from a layout resource
理解分析,java程序 xml程序 R.java文件
程序是怎么运行的,应该首先运行的还是java程序,有个main activity,初始化就运行的程序,运行的时候程序里面有个onCreate方法,会被调用,这里面就可以去调用各种xml布局文件进行布置。